Question
Find the number of diagonals of an n-shaded polygon. In particular, find the number of diagonals when: n = 12

Solution
Two points are needed to draw a segment.
A polygon of n sides has n vertices.
So, in a polygon of n sides, there will be
nC2 segments, which include its sides and diagonals both.
Since the polygon has n sides, the number of its diagonals is nC2 – n
Here, n = 12
∴ The number of diagonals = 12C2 – 12
= `(12!)/((12 - 2)!2!) - 12`
= `(12 xx 11)/2 - 12`
= 66 – 12
= 54
